Melt and mold ‘em into little shot glasses!

First, melt the candies on a baking sheet at about 275°F for around 10 minutes, or until they’re flat and melted.

Then, peel off the warm, melted candy -- let them cool a bit first, of course! -- and mold it around shot glasses.

Once hardened, they’re ready to be used as shot glasses!
